The bravest battle that ever was fought!

Shall I tell you where and when?

On the maps of the world you will find it not;

'Twas fought by the mothers of men.

Nay not with the cannon of battle-shot,

With a sword or noble pen;

Nay, not with eloquent words or thought

From mouth of wonderful men!

But deep in a walled-up woman's heart --

Of a woman that would not yield,

But bravely, silently bore her part --

Lo, there is the battlefield!

No marshalling troops, no bivouac song,

No banner to gleam and wave;

But oh! those battles, they last so long --

From babyhood to the grave.

Yet, faithful still as a bridge of stars,

She fights in her walled-up town --

Fights on and on in her endless wars

Then silent, unseen, goes down.

Oh, ye with banners and battle-shot,

And soldiers to shout and paise!

I tell you the kingliest victories fought

Were fought in those silent ways.

O spotless woman in a world of shame,

With splendid and silent scorn,

Go back to God as white as you came --

The Kingliest warrior born!
